After literally years of passively searching, I finally cobbled together the four pieces of SIGLA door glass I needed to complete the correct glass on my bus.
When I got the bus in '06, it had all correct, well preserved SIGLA glass except for the door glass, which had been busted out.
Installed on the weekend as it's been snowing and well below zero here for the last week or more..
I'm very pleased that the bus finally has all correct glass again. _________________ The greatest obstacle to discovery is not ignorance, but the illusion of knowledge
